• VCM Technology VCM Logo
VCM technology is responsible for the classic compressor, EQ, analog tape deck, and stompbox effect simulations in the DM2000VCM. VCM (Virtual Circuitry Modeling) technology actually models the characteristics of analog circuitry – right down to the last resistor and capacitor. VCM technology goes well beyond simply analyzing and modeling electronic components and emulating the sound of old equipment. It's capable of capturing subtleties that simple digital simulations cannot even approach, while actually creating ideal examples of sought-after vintage gear.
• iSSP TechnologyiSSP Logo
iSSP technology is the key to the DM2000VCMs incredible selection of surround post-production effects. iSSP stands for "Interactive Spatial Sound Processing," and is Yamaha's original new spatial sound effect system. Designed through extensive research and exhaustive testing, this technology offers unparalleled reality, operability and originality for surround processing applications. It delivers unprecedented sound-field positioning precision and versatility, as well as realistic sound source movement effects with simple operation that allows simulations of an almost unlimited variety of spatial environments.
• REV-XREV-X Logo
"REV-X" is the advanced algorithm behind Yamaha's newest generation of reverb and ambience programs, offering unprecedented reverberation depth and realism with smooth decay. REV-X technology takes full advantage of the 24-bit 96-kHz processing capability of the DM2000 for reverb and ambience effects that have the reassuring warmth and reality of natural acoustic environments.

The Version 2 SOFTWARE for DM2000 has been created in response to the many ideas and requests we have received from our valued end users. In addition to the significant overall performance enhancements, the Version 2 system Software offers a range of new features that add advanced capabilities for audio production, broadcast, and live applications.

But there's more. You also get the capability to install the new optional ADD-ON EFFECTS, providing a range of state-of-the-art effect programs in addition to the current internal effect list.

The version 2 system software is offered as an Upgrade Kit: DM2000V2K, to be installed in the current DM2000 digital consoles in use.

The Version 2 SOFTWARE UPGRADE KIT also includes a new and improved STUDIO MANAGER application for Windows 2000/XP and Mac OS X platforms.
